    Most widgets have a constructor that allows you to apply changes to the functioning of the widget.

    Here is the constructor for the Nivo Slider settings

    $('#slider').nivoSlider ({}

    effect: 'random', / / Specify defines as: "bend, bland, sliceDown.

    slices: 15, / / for the animations of the slice

    boxCols: 8, / / for the animations of the box

    boxRows: 4, / / for the animations of the box

    animSpeed: 500, / / speed of slide transition

    pauseTime: 3000, / / how long each slide will show

    startSlide: 0, / / Set from slides (index 0)

    directionNav: true, / / next & previous navigation

    controlNav: true, / / 1,2,3... Navigation

    controlNavThumbs: false, / / use tiles for a control Nav

    pauseOnHover: true, / / Stop animation while hovering

    manualAdvance: false, / / hand strength of transitions

    prevText: 'Prev', / / Prev directionNav text

    nextText: 'Next', / / Next directionNav text

    randomStart: false, / / Start on a slide at random

    Beforechange: function() {}, / / triggers before a transition between slides

    Event: function() {}, / / triggers a transition between slides

    slideshowEnd: function() {}, / / triggers after all slides should have been disclosed

    lastSlide: function() {}, / / when the last slide is indicated

    postcharge: function() {} / / triggers when the cursor is loaded

    });

    The effect parameter can be one of the following:

    • sliceDown
    • sliceDownLeft
    • sliceUp
    • sliceUpLeft
    • sliceUpDown
    • sliceUpDownLeft
    • fold
    • fade
    • random
    • slideInRight
    • slideInLeft
    • boxRandom
    • boxRain
    • boxRainReverse
    • boxRainGrow
    • boxRainGrowReverse

  • How to change the speed of playback on Windows Media player?

    Original title: slow down the Windows Media feature?

    Is there a slowdown function to allow me to slow down or speed up a song?  I use Windows 8

    Hi Andy,.
     

    Welcome to the Microsoft community.

     
    I would like to give you some information:

     
    You want to adjust the speed of playback of multimedia content on Windows Media player?

     
    If you try to adjust the speed of playback on Windows Media player, you can follow the steps:

     
    (a) click on Switch button playing in the lower right of the player.
    (b) right click on a space open in the player (such as to the left of the stop button), point to enhancements, and then click play speed settings.
    (c) move the speed slider to play at the speed that you want to read the file, or click the slow, normal or fast links.

    You can disable hibernation if it is enabled and you do not...

    When you Hibernate your computer, Windows saves the contents of the system memory in the hiberfil.sys file. As a result, the size of the hiberfil.sys file will always be equal to the amount of physical memory in your system. If you don't use the Hibernate feature and want to reclaim the space used by Windows for the hiberfil.sys file, perform the following steps:

    -Start the Control Panel Power Options applet (go to start, settings, Control Panel, and then click Power Options).
    -Select the Hibernate tab, uncheck "Activate the hibernation", and then click OK. Although you might think otherwise, selecting never under "Hibernate" option on the power management tab does not delete the hiberfil.sys file.
    -Windows remove the "Hibernate" option on the power management tab and delete the hiberfil.sys file.

    You can control the amount of space your system restore can use...

    1. Click Start, right click my computer and then click Properties.
    2. click on the System Restore tab.
    3. highlight one of your readers (or C: If you only) and click on the button "settings".
    4 change the percentage of disk space you want to allow... I suggest moving the slider until you have about 1 GB (1024 MB or close to that...)
    5. click on OK. Then click OK again.

    You can create more free space in C by doing one of the following suggested measures.

    The default allocation for the restoration of the system is 12% on your C partition is more generous. I have them would be reduced by 700 MB. Make my computer right click on your icon, and select System Restore. Place the cursor on your C drive select settings but this time find the slider and drag it to the left until it shows 700 MB and output. When you get to the settings screen, click on apply and OK and leave.

    A flaw that might be useless which is for temporary internet files, especially if you keep no copies on the disk offline. Setting the default value is 3% of the walk. Depending on your attitude to copies offline, you could bring it to 1% or 2%. In Internet Explorer, select Tools, Internet Options, general, temporary Internet files, settings to make the change. At the same time, look at the number of days, the story stands.

    The default allocation for the basket is 10% of the disk. Change to 5%, which should be enough. In Windows Explorer hover over your Recycle Bin, right click and select Properties, Global and move the slider from 10% to 5%. However, try to let you become so complete that if it is complete and you delete a file by mistake it will bypass the Recycle Bin and have gone forever.

    If your drive is formatted as NTFS another potential gain arises with your operating system on your C drive. In the Windows directory of your C partition you will some uninstall files in your Windows folder in general: $NtServicePackUninstall$ and $NtUninstallKB282010$ etc. These files can be compressed or not compressed. If compressed text the name of the folder appears in blue. If these files are not compressed you can compress. Right-click on each folder and select Properties, general, advanced, and check the box before you compress contents to save disk space. On the general tab, you can see the winning amount by deducting the size on disk size. File compression is only an option on an NTFS formatted disk partition / partition.
